Energy Savings of Warehouse Lighting in LED

Switching to LED lighting in warehouses offers substantial energy savings, making it an attractive option for facility managers. The following table outlines different types of warehouse lighting fixtures, their applications, typical mounting heights, and the energy savings percentage achieved by upgrading to LED.

Lighting Fixture TypeApplicationTypical Mounting HeightEnergy Savings (%)
High Bay LED LightsGeneral warehouse lighting15-40 feet60%
Low Bay LED LightsSmaller spaces, lower ceilings12-20 feet50%
LED Strip LightsAisle and shelf lighting8-15 feet55%
LED Flood LightsOutdoor and security lightingVariable65%

These energy savings not only reduce operational costs but also contribute to a more sustainable and environmentally friendly operation. The choice of fixture type and mounting height is crucial to maximizing these benefits, ensuring that the lighting is both effective and efficient.

Every Warehouse in Greenwood city, Mississippi is Different

Understanding the unique characteristics of each warehouse in Greenwood city is essential when planning a lighting upgrade. The first step is to assess the existing lighting setup, which involves identifying the types and models of current fixtures, their wattage, and input voltage. This information is critical as it helps determine the compatibility of new LED fixtures and the potential energy savings.

Additionally, the dimensions of the warehouse facility play a significant role in the lighting design. Larger spaces may require more powerful fixtures or a greater number of lights to ensure adequate illumination. The primary operations conducted within the warehouse also influence lighting needs. For instance, warehouses focused on detailed assembly work may require brighter, more focused lighting compared to those used for storage.

By thoroughly evaluating these factors, facility managers can make informed decisions about the most suitable LED lighting solutions, ensuring that the upgrade meets both operational and energy efficiency goals.

Other Considerations for Greenwood city, Mississippi

When selecting lighting fixtures for warehouses in Greenwood city, Mississippi, it’s important to consider local climate-specific conditions. The region’s climate can affect the performance and longevity of lighting fixtures, making it crucial to choose products designed to withstand local environmental factors.

Moreover, local codes or utility rebates may necessitate the inclusion of lighting controls such as daylight sensors or motion sensor controls. These controls not only enhance energy savings by adjusting lighting based on occupancy and natural light availability but also improve the overall efficiency of the lighting system.

Implementing these advanced controls can lead to additional cost savings and may qualify the facility for rebates or incentives, further offsetting the initial investment in LED lighting.
